This Sweet Hawaiian Chicken is probably the EASIEST recipe I have ever posted. This recipe has a deliciously sweet flavor that will have your mouth watering for seconds. One thing to note for this recipe, the chicken can quickly overcook and dry out. So cook start with 6 hours on low then check it. If there is no pink and reaches an internal temperature of 165 degrees Fahrenheit, then you are good to go. If not, continue cooking in 30-minute increments until ready.
